Nathan Kress

Nathan Kress was born on November 18, 1992 in Glendale, California. He started his career by appearing in commercials. He had also done voice-over roles, most notable as Easy and Tough Pup in the 1998 film Babe: Pig in the City.

He has since made appearances in various television shows including Jimmy Kimmel Live!, House, Standoff, Without a Trace, The Suite Life of Zack & Cody, and Drake & Josh.

In 2007, he gained wider recognition for his role as Freddie Benson in the Nickelodeon television series iCarly. He went on to star in the television movies Gym Teacher: The Movie and iCarly: iGo to Japan.

    It is a long time now since Liverpool last broke the British transfer record during summer of 1995 and, Given how the football financial landscape has changed since, can never happen again.

    On three previous times the signings of Kenny Dalglish (to have 440,000 from 1977), andrew d Beardsley (1.9m in chnlove real or fake 1987) on top of that Dean Saunders (2.9m as part of 1991) The Anfield coffers were plundered to bring a top level forward to L4 and send out a message to all of those other league that the Reds meant business.

    The three record buys in question enjoyed varying degrees of success but up to date time Liverpool splashed the cash in such a manner was on one of the English game’s most mercurial talents and, Over 25 a number of on, Examination of his time of Merseyside still makes it impossible not to wonder what might have been had a Reds side with such rich potential fulfilled its undoubted promise.

    The lavishly gifted Stan Collymore visited Anfield for 8.5m back in July 1995, Smashing the 7m manchester united had paid Newcastle for Andy Cole seven months earlier, with the expectation being he might be the final piece of the jigsaw to restore Liverpool to power after the Old Trafford club’s dominance of the opening years of the Premier League era.

    Despite more than respectable goal tallies for him and strike partner Robbie Fowler amid probably the most swashbucklingly entertaining football seen at Anfield in years, Collymore would spend only two seasons with the Reds during a period largely now looked back on along with the frustrated prism of wasted opportunity, Even though there were sparkling moments which hinted that a club initially seemingly that is left behind by a new brand of football and breed of footballers was ready to strike back.

    The summer of 1995 saw the biggest wave of optimism around Anfield for many years.

    The dismal opening couple of Premier League seasons which had seen Liverpool stumble to previously unspeakable league finishes of sixth and eighth had led to manager Graeme Souness being replaced by the succession from within of Roy Evans, The of the Boot Room boys in chairman David Moores’s words when hiring him in January 1994.

    Evans’s first full season in charge saw silverware return to Anfield with the League Cup won following Wembley victory over Bolton Wanderers as the Scouse coach’s tactical innovation of playing three central defenders with wing backs started to make the best of a Liverpool squad which featured an intriguing blend of young talent like Fowler, ken McManaman, Jamie Redknapp and rob Jones, adept older heads like Ian Rush, John Barnes and mirielle Thomas, And shrewd defensive acquisitions like John Scales and Phil Babb.

    With the League Cup triumph having secured the Reds a resume Europe in the UEFA Cup, There was real expectation that 1995/96 would see Liverpool build on the undoubted promise of the previous campaign and launch a credible assault on the league title with the absence of the championship trophy from Anfield already stretching to half a decade.

    With popular striker Ian Rush who as club captain had lifted the trophy at Wembley set to turn 34 soon into the new campaign, Many fans hoped steps would be taken to bolster the young but raw talents of a strikeforce led by 20 year old Fowler who had rattled home 31 goals in all competitions the last season.

    Having begun his career in reference to his local non league side Stafford Rangers, The 24 yr old Collymore had gained a grounding in league football with spells at Crystal Palace and Southend United before a 2.2m move to Nottingham Forest in 1993 saw him during the next two years carve a reputation for himself as one of the most exciting young strikers in the country.

    His stamina, Pace and eye for goal saw him score 22 times in 1994/95 to help newly promoted Forest gain a third place Premier League finish and obtain a first England cap against Japan in that summer’s pre cursor to Euro 96, any Umbro Cup.

    Collymore was hot property and likely to be targeted by the country’s top clubs but Liverpool had clearly decided he was the man they wanted and, Despite FA Cup holders Everton agreeing a fee with Forest and holding talks with the golfer, Once the Reds made their interest known it soon became clear Anfield is your destination of choice.
